Position Summary:
We are seeking a Music Director to lead our music ministry with creativity, excellence, and inclusivity. This role develops and directs a blended worship program that honors classical traditions while embracing innovative, “outside the box” approaches that reflect the diversity and future of UMCPS. The Music Director will lead choirs, ensembles, and praise bands; cultivate congregational participation; and nurture musicians in a supportive, grace‑filled environment.
Key Responsibilities:
● Shape and lead a blended music ministry (traditional, gospel, global, contemporary).
● Direct and rehearse choir, praise team, handbell choir, and ensembles.
● Provide music for Sunday worship, holy days, weddings, funerals, and special events.
● Recruit, mentor, and support musicians of all skill levels.
● Collaborate with clergy and worship staff on weekly planning.
● Integrate technology (screens, livestream, multimedia) into worship.
● Manage music library, licensing, and ministry budget.
● Build community connections through concerts, partnerships, and outreach.
